What do you say in a character reference?
Generally, a good character reference should include the following five pieces of information:
- Start off by discussing your relationship with the applicant.
- Establish how long you have known the applicant.
- Talk about their positive qualities and give examples.
- Finish with a recommendation for the position.
What should a character letter include?
Character letters should include your name, mailing address, phone number and email address so that the court can verify your information. They should be addressed either to the Honorable [FIRST NAME] [LAST NAME] or Judge [FIRST NAME] [LAST NAME].
How do you write a character reference for a colleague?
Start by looking at what it’s called—a character reference letter. In other words, you should be writing about the person’s character traits, their personal values, and the qualities that might make them a trustworthy hire. You can touch on their work ethic and talents, but that’s really secondary.

How do you ask a professional reference?
Want a Professional Reference? How to Ask and What to Expect
- Ask a direct supervisor or professional mentor.
- Inform the person beforehand and give plenty of notice.
- Give your reference the appropriate background information.
- Inform the person how you’ll use their reference.

What questions are asked for a character reference?
Character Reference Checks
- How long have you known the applicant?
- What can you tell me about the applicant’s reason for changing jobs?
- If provided the opportunity, would you hire the applicant?
- What can you tell me about the applicant’s personality?
- What can you tell me about the applicant’s work ethic?
